Perfect the pre-ceremony checklist

A flawless wedding day begins the moment you wake up. To keep stress at bay, establish a precise morning schedule that coordinates your hair and makeup artists with your bridal party. Ensure your bridal emergency kit is fully packed with safety pins, blotting papers, fabric tape, and breath mints. Additionally, lay out all your details—such as your rings, invitation suite, family heirlooms, and veil—in one designated area so your photographer can capture those crucial detail shots without disrupting your preparation.

Secure the reception transition

The final piece of your bridal planning ensures a seamless shift into party mode. Before joining the cocktail hour, arrange a private room where you and your partner can share a quiet toast and a few appetizers alone. Communicate clearly with your maid of honor and venue coordinator about bustling your gown’s train right after the grand entrance. Finally, hand off a designated touch-up clutch containing your lipstick and setting powder to a family member, guaranteeing you remain radiant from your first dance until the final grand exit.
